The Stonewall Inn – upstairs

The Stonewall Inn upstairs is a historic gay bar in Manhattan's Greenwich Village known as the epicenter of the 1969 Stonewall riots that ignited the modern LGBTQ rights movement, distinguished by its designation as the first National Historic Landmark for LGBTQ culture and its vibrant, inclusive vibe as an active recreational tavern.
